e0b760a5f6 arm64: dts: sdm845: Fixup OPP table for all qup devices
This OPP table was based on the clock VDD-FMAX tables seen in
downstream code, however it turns out the downstream clock
driver does update these tables based on later/production
rev of the chip and whats seen in the tables belongs to an
early engineering rev of the SoC.
Fix up the OPP tables such that it now matches with the
production rev of sdm845 SoC.

433f9a5729 arm64: dts: sdm845: add Inline Crypto Engine registers and clock
Add the vendor-specific registers and clock for Qualcomm ICE (Inline
Crypto Engine) to the device tree node for the UFS host controller on
sdm845, so that the ufs-qcom driver will be able to use inline crypto.

Use a separate register range rather than extending the main UFS range
because there's a gap between the two, and the ICE registers are
vendor-specific.  (Actually, the hardware claims that the ICE range also
includes the array of standard crypto configuration registers; however,
on this SoC the Linux kernel isn't permitted to access them directly.)

13cadb34e5 arm64: dts: sdm845: Add OPP table for all qup devices
qup has a requirement to vote on the performance state of the CX domain
in sdm845 devices. Add OPP tables for these and also add power-domains
property for all qup instances for uart and spi.
i2c does not support scaling and uses a fixed clock.

af85ef13a5 arm64: dts: qcom: sdm845: Add the missing clock on the videocc
We're transitioning over to requiring the Qualcomm Video Clock
Controller to specify all the input clocks.  Let's add the one input
clock for the videocc for sdm845.

NOTE: Until the Linux driver for sdm845's video is updated, this clock
will not actually be used in Linux.  It will continue to use global
clock names to match things up.

43b0a4b482 arm64: dts: qcom: sdm845-cheza: delete zap-shader
This is unused on cheza.  Delete the node to get ride of the reserved-
memory section, and to avoid the driver from attempting to load a zap
shader that doesn't exist every time it powers up the GPU.

This also avoids a massive amount of dmesg spam about missing zap fw:
  msm ae00000.mdss: [drm:adreno_request_fw] *ERROR* failed to load
qcom/a630_zap.mdt: -2
  adreno 5000000.gpu: [drm:adreno_zap_shader_load] *ERROR* Unable to
load a630_zap.mdt
